The TV can usually be hidden out of sight when not in use, giving you extra space in your room for other furniture. This storage bed is similar to an ottoman, with a lift-up base for storage, and comes with a TV in the foot of the bed. TV beds double up as a storage and space saving bed. So, when measuring up for this type of storage bed, be sure to check the space you need for the drawers to pull out fully. Divan beds can have 2 or 4 drawers, on either side or both sides of the bed. A bed with drawers is useful for storing extra clothes, and adds a little extra storage without compromising on style. The base of a divan bed contains drawers for you to store your items. This type of storage bed gives you the most storage space and is perfect for rooms without enough room to open drawers. Ottoman beds have an easy-to-use mechanism that allows the base to lift up from the foot or the side of the bed.
